Transaction d71ecfd491cac924b93c7463f4438e3b33a91587569d68896bb49d79742c711c
1 Input
1 Output
-
d71ecfd491cac924b93c7463f4438e3b33a91587569d68896bb49d79742c711c:0
- value
- 66515
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 16d8bd691d967355fb4e4481078c1d1474aef005291106a7166062edc95a8ec6
- address
- tb1pzmvt66gajee4t76wgjqs0rqaz362auq99ygsdfckvp3wmj263mrqcsvmeg